Abstract
This application discloses a kind of data transmission method, system, device and computer readable storage mediums, are applied to PHP server, using the long connection between destination server pre-established, send request of data to destination server;Utilize the long data for connecting and receiving destination server and sending.Data transmission method provided by the present application, the long connection between destination server that PHP server by utilizing pre-establishes, request of data is sent to destination server, and the data that destination server is sent are received using long connection, namely PHP server exchanges data by long connection between destination server, in this way after PHP server establishes vice-minister connection, it can repeatedly be communicated with destination server, the number that PHP server disconnected, re-established connection is reduced, the stability of PHP server is improved.A kind of data transmission system, device and computer readable storage medium provided by the present application also solve the problems, such as relevant art.

The application provides a kind of data transmission method, is applied to PHP server.
Referring to Fig.1, Fig. 1 is the flow diagram of the application first embodiment.
In the first embodiment, this method may comprise steps of:
Step S101: using the long connection between destination server pre-established, data are sent to destination server
Request.
In practical application, PHP server can be first with the long connection between destination server pre-established, to mesh
Mark server send request of data so that destination server respond the request of data and obtain PHP server needed for data.
The time and mode that long connection is established between PHP server and destination server can be determine according to actual needs.
Step S102: the data that destination server is sent are received using long connection.
In practical application, PHP server is after being sent to destination server for request of data using long connection, target clothes
Business device can search data corresponding with the request of data, and the data found are sent to PHP service by length connection
Device, correspondingly, the long connection of PHP server by utilizing receives the data that destination server is sent.

In the first embodiment, the condition that PHP server pre-establishes the long connection between destination server can basis
Actual needs determines, for example can periodically establish length connection, and length connection etc., concrete application field are established under extraneous control
Jing Zhong, PHP server send data to destination server and ask using the long connection between destination server pre-established
Before asking, long it can also be connected when needing to destination server request data, establish between destination server.Namely
PHP resettles the long connection between destination server when needing to destination server request data, correspondingly, the external world can lead to
Cross to the instruction that PHP server is sent to destination server request data and give PFP server, with control PHP server establish with
Long connection between destination server etc..
In the first embodiment, it establishes for the ease of PHP server and is connected the length between destination server, and in order to just
It can establish when length of the PHP server between foundation and destination server connects in management of the PHP server to long connection
Long connection middleware;Establish the long connection between long connection middleware and destination server.Namely PHP server is creating itself
Long connection middleware, and the length established between long connection middleware and destination server connects, in this way, subsequent PHP server exists
When needing to communicate with destination server, length connection middleware can be called directly and communicated with destination server, and
When not needing to keep be long and connecting, can directly destroy length connection middleware and then disconnect long connection namely PHP server can be with
By long connection Middleware implementation to the centralized management of long connection.
In concrete application scene, PHP server is connected using the length between destination server pre-established, to mesh
When marking server transmission request of data, request of data can be sent to long connection middleware, so that the long middleware that connects is using length
It connects to destination server and sends request of data;It, can be with correspondingly, when receiving the data that destination server is sent using long connection
Receive the data from destination server of long connection middleware forwarding.
In concrete application scene, PHP server can be according to practical need in the type of the long connection middleware itself created
It flexibly to determine, for example the type of long connection middleware can be the process etc. in PHP server, then PHP server is being established
When long connection middleware, the long connection middleware that type is process can establish;Correspondingly, sending number to long connection middleware
When according to request, request of data can be sent to long connection middleware by Unix domain socket agreement.It can certainly
Request of data etc. is sent to long connection middleware by port numbers agreement.
In the first embodiment, in order to improve the stability of PHP server, PHP server can keep long connection to continue
In connected state, in addition, being easy to appear disconnection after the long connection between PHP server and destination server continues for some time
The case where, it is based on such situation, in order to guarantee that long connection is continuously in connected state, and is kept to mitigate PHP server
Long junction in the service pressure of connected state, PHP server using long connection receive data that destination server is sent it
Afterwards, the accumulation duration not carried out data transmission between destination server can also be accumulated;Judge to accumulate whether duration is more than or equal to
Preset duration;If so, send detection data packet to destination server, and the transmission result judgement based on detection data packet is long connects
It connects and whether is in an off state, if long junction re-establishes long connection in off-state.Preset duration and detection data packet
Can flexibly it determine according to actual needs.
